WebWhat were Singapore’s GST rate over the years? When GST was introduced in 1994, the rate was 3%. This was increased to 4% in 2003, 5% in 2004 and 7% on 1 July 2007. WebSep 29, 2024 · Foreign suppliers of low value goods are required to register for GST in Singapore where they pass both of the following threshold tests: Where an overseas seller’s annual global turnover exceeds SGD $1m and the annual value of B2C low value goods into Singapore exceeds SGD $1m, then GST registration is mandatory in Singapore.
